Who says newsrooms don’t have any fun anymore?
Each spring for the past decade, The Star-Ledger has launched the Munchmobile’s summer season with a marching band, a parade through the newsroom and a lot of silliness. (For those not in the know, the Munchmobile is a custom van with a giant hot dog on top that travels New Jersey with a crew of guest munchers seeking the state’s best eats. Captained by the inimitable Pete Genovese, it has become something of a Jersey icon, spawning a blog and even a book due out soon.)
